ISI entrances test your basic mathematical and problem solving ability. You need to give special focus to Calculus, Geometry, Inequalities, Number theory etc. Some books by standard foreign authors will aid you in preparation for these topics. The authors include IA Maron,  David Burton, Arthur Engel etc. For interview, they generally ask you to solve few tricky mathematics questions itself. Just be confident and answer without fear.

As you have asked for the eligiblity criteria in ISI Kolkata for M.Tech, then for getting selected in M.Tech (QROR) their are following eligibility criteria which i am listing below.

1. Master’s Degree in Statistics with Physics and Chemistry at the (10+2) level; or

2. Master’s Degree in Mathematics with Statistics as a subject at undergraduate or post-graduate            level, and Physics and Chemistry at the (10+2) level; or  

3. BE/B Tech degree or any other qualification considered equivalent (such as AMIE).

ISI (Indian Statistical Institute) conducts an exam or an admission test every year. This exam will give you an opportunity to get admission in the Postgraduate, diploma and doctorate programs offered at Indian Statistical Institute.

  • Step 1: You have to apply online for registration to appear for the entrance exam. For PG courses you have to apply on the admission portal
  • Step 2: after registration, the institute will provide you an admit card. You can download the admit card from their website
  • Step 3: You have to appear for the exam
  • Step 4: Check the result after it gets published. ISI Kolkata results can be seen in their notice board
  • Step 5: According to their marks and eligibility criteria, the candidates should prepare for their interview.
  • Step 6: After interview, if the candidate is selected then He/She should complete the verification and other Formalities
  • Step 7: Institute will commence their classes.

The syllabus of Examination are

  • Geometry: Plane geometry. The geometry of 2 dimensions with Cartesian and polar coordinates. Equation of a line, the angle between two lines, distance from a point to a line. Concept of a Locus. Area of a triangle. Equations of circle, parabola, ellipse and hyperbola and equations of their tangents and normals. Mensuration.
  • Algebra: Sets, operations on sets. Prime numbers, factorization of integers and divisibility. Rational and irrational numbers. Permutations and combinations, basic probability. Binomial Theorem. Logarithms. Polynomials: Remainder Theorem, Theory of quadratic equations and expressions, relations between roots and coefficients. Arithmetic and geometric progressions. Inequalities involving arithmetic, geometric & harmonic means. 
  • Trigonometry: Measures of angles. Trigonometric and inverse trigonometric functions. Trigonometric identities including addition formulae, solutions of trigonometric equations.
  • Calculus: Sequences - bounded sequences, monotone sequences, the limit of a sequence. Functions, one-one functions, onto functions. Limits and continuity. Derivatives and methods of differentiation. The slope of a curve. Tangents and normals. Maxima and minima. Using calculus to sketch graphs of functions.

About the exam


The exam consists of two parts:

Part 1: 30 questions 120 marks and duration is 2 hrs MCQ 

Part 2: Discipline wise section which consisting of MCQ or descriptive questions.

The cut off for B.Stats. depends upon the difficulty level of exam 

Since results for written examination are out cut off for 2019 is

 GEN UGA ≥ 73/120 and( UGA + 3 ∗ UGB ) ≥ 147/360

OBC UGA ≥ 65.7/ 120 and( UGA + 3 ∗ UGB ) ≥ 132.3/360

SC/ST/PwD UGA ≥ 51.1/ 120 and( UGA + 3 ∗ UGB ) ≥ 102.9/ 360
